Andamooka Airport (IATA: ADO, ICAO: YAMK) serves Andamooka, AU.
Andamooka Airport (YAMK (ADO)) is a public-use aerodrome located near Andamooka, South Australia. It is managed and operated by the Andamooka Opal Fields Tourism Association.
The airport features an unsealed runway, 06/24, which is 1,210 meters long with 100-meter clearways. Facilities include solar-powered runway lighting, a remote weather station, and live monitoring systems.
Andamooka Airport supports regional aviation operations, including medical, emergency, and private aircraft movements. It has been operational for Royal Flying Doctor Service (RFDS) operations for patient transfers and medical support since June 30, 2025. The airport was formally opened on January 21, 2026, and is undergoing further development to enhance aviation access and support tourism.

Where is Andamooka Airport located?
Andamooka Airport is located in Andamooka, AU, at an elevation of 76 ft. Its IATA code is ADO and ICAO code is YAMK.
